Hinduja unveils $500m infra vehicle - report
The Hinduja Group, the diversified conglomerate founded in Mumbai by the Hinduja family, reportedly plans to establish a $500-million fund that will invest in Indian infrastructure projects.

Bamboo Finance backs Greenlight Planet in $4m round
Bamboo Finance has invested in Greenlight Planet, a manufacturer of solar-powered lanterns, in a $4 million funding round alongside existing investor P.K. Sinha, co-founder of ZS Associates.
Noah eyes $2.8b China real estate fund
Noah Holdings, the Shanghai-headquartered third-party financial advisory company, is seeking to launch a real estate fund worth as much as RMB18 billion ($2.85 billion). It will target cash-strapped developers who are seeking new sources of funding.

VC-backed DangDang's CFO resigns
Dangdang, the New York-listed Chinese e-commerce company, announced that its CFO Conor Chia-huang Yang is leaving the company for personal reasons.
Baring PE India promotes two to partner level
Baring Private Equity Partners India has promoted Amit Chander and Keshav Misra to partner level.
Wolseley-backed Nextmedia acquires magazines from CVC's ACP
Nextmedia, the Australian magazine publisher owned by Wolseley Private Equity, has acquired two publications from ACP Magazines, the magazine division of CVC Asia Pacific-backed Nine Entertainment.
PAG backs Haitong's $1.8b Hong Kong offering
PAG has become a cornerstone investor in the Shanghai-listed brokerage Haitong Securities' Hong Kong IPO, buying $300 million worth of shares as part of a potential $1.8 billion offering.
Blackstone pays $770m for Dexus Property assets
The Blackstone Group has paid $770 million for 65 US industrial assets owned by Australia’s Dexus Property Group. Investing via affiliates of Blackstone Real Estate Partners VII, the firm will acquire properties including three warehouses leased to...
China's Chengwei, Tsing back US materials company
Polyera, a US-based supplier of functional materials for the electronics and opto-electronics industries, has secured $24.5 million in Series C funding from investors including Chengwei Capital and Tsing Capital.
InnoSpring launches US-China technology incubator
InnoSpring, Silicon Valley's first US-China technology incubator, began operations last week to support the expansion of US and Chinese start-ups beyond their home countries. The incubator also announced the establishment of its InnoSpring Seed Fund.

Investors inject $45.5b in China clean energy
Investment in China’s clean energy sector stood at $45.5 billion last year, which saw China lose its number-one status to the US for the first time since 2009.
EMPEA: More than 50% of LPs to expand SE Asia footprint
Global LPs expect to increase commitments to emerging markets in the next two years, including less-penetrated areas such as Southeast Asia and Latin America, according to a survey released by the Emerging Markets Private Equity Association (EMPEA).
Unitus Seed Fund backs Indian rural distribution start-up
Unitus Seed Fund, a US-based VC firm that targets social start-ups, has invested in Chennai-based Villgro Innovation Marketing (VIM) in a seed series of funding alongside a group of angel investors.
NSSF to expand investments in state-owned enterprises
China's National Council for Social Security Fund (NSSF) will lift investments in state-owned enterprises (SOEs), Dai Xianglong, the fund’s chairman, said Thursday.
